2021 Mazda 3 F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2021 Mazda 3 in Australia?

The 2021 Mazda 3 has an average fuel consumption of approximately 6.5 L/100 km for combined city and highway driving, based on Australian testing conditions. This makes it an efficient choice for both urban commuting and longer trips.

What is the reliability rating of a 2021 Mazda 3?

The 2021 Mazda 3 is known for its strong reliability ratings, frequently earning high scores in consumer reviews and reliability studies. Mazda vehicles generally have a reputation for building durable cars that require less frequent repairs.

What are the maintenance costs of a 2021 Mazda 3?

The maintenance costs for the 2021 Mazda 3 are estimated to be moderate. Typical servicing intervals are every 10,000 km or 12 months, and standard maintenance can range from approximately AUD 300 to AUD 800 per service, depending on the specific maintenance required. Using genuine parts can help ensure longevity and performance.

How does the 2021 Mazda 3 compare to other models in its class?

The 2021 Mazda 3 stands out in its class, particularly in terms of design, driving dynamics, and interior quality. Compared to rivals such as the Toyota Corolla and Honda Civic, the Mazda 3 offers a sportier feel and a more premium interior finish. Its fuel economy is competitive, and it provides excellent safety ratings, making it a well-rounded option.
